遵循PDFTron BLOG文章第2步时,libTools.a出现问题:getting-started-on-ios

步骤1,有效。我有一个工作正常的PDF查看器,但除分页和缩放外没有其他控件。

当我添加libTools.a库(SDK中附带的一个库,或使用Tools.xcodeproj构建的一个库)时,对于我尝试的每种平台(模拟器,ipad2,iphone6-每种架构名称均发生更改),都会收到以下错误消息:
Undefined symbols for architecture x86_64: "_OBJC_CLASS_$_DraggableCollectionViewFlowLayout", referenced from: objc-class-ref in libTools.a(ThumbnailsViewController.o)ld: symbol(s) not found for architecture x86_64
示例代码运行正常。这是我在应用程序中的实现。

该项目的其余第三方框架由CocoaPods管理。

我必须忽略一些简单的事情...想法?

最佳答案

从错误消息来看,听起来您可能需要将/ Lib / src / PDFViewCtrlTools / ThirdParty / DraggableCollectionView添加到您的项目中。 ThumbnailsViewController这是必需的。

10-08 12:30